Position Summary

Assists program director in the management and direction of resident training program ensuring program compliance and maintaining essential documentation for program. Coordinates educational activities for incoming and current residents and functions as a liaison between residents, departments, attending physicians, administration and outside institutions. Also functions as Program Coordinator for the R25 Training Program, ensuring alignment with NIH requirements for documentation and compliance. Residency and R25 responsibilities will be split roughly 50/50.

Job Description

Primary Duties & Responsibilities:

Residency

  • Reviews applications of residency or fellowship program applicants, schedules and coordinates yearly interviews for selection of new residents or fellows, establishes files of completed applications and related materials, corresponds with individuals and those who are accepted into the program.
  • Coordinates residents/fellows schedules, rotations, vacations, call and conference schedules and documents attendance and absence excuses.
  • Arranges for phone or pagers, white coats, lockers and mailboxes and for certificates of program completion.
  • Reviews ACGME requirements for the program(s) and evaluates program(s) to assess and ensure compliance.
  • Maintains all records and documentation required by the ACGME and supervises the collection of data fulfilling requirements of ACGME and other licensing and credentialing boards.
  • Prepares reports and compiles statistics.
  • Compiles faculty and resident evaluations.
  • Participates in preparation of budget as it relates to residency/fellowship program.
  • Performs other duties as assigned.

R25

  • Assist with R25 trainee recruitment, onboarding/offboarding, and tracking.
  • Coordinates mentor/mentee activities, resident research requirements, and RCR compliance.
  • Arranges R25 educational/research programs (ACDC, Ogura Day, CREST, Critical Appraisal, ABT).
  • Handle event logistics, speaker coordination, travel, evaluations, and on-site support.
  • Tracks publications, alumni, research projects, and PGY3 research residents.
  • Coordinates medical student travel and resident clinical elective rotations.
  • Maintains program communications, marketing materials, and website updates.
  • Assist with preparing NIH RPPR and various program reports.
  • Schedules advisory committee meetings, exit interviews, and program reporting.
